Veggie diet beats vegan for diabetes prevention benefits

A recent study published in Clinical Nutrition has found that including dairy in a veggie diet can help control blood sugar levels better than a plant-only diet. The study, which included 30 participants, showed that those following the lacto-vegetarian diet had lower average blood sugar levels compared to those on the vegan diet.

Flower strips could save apple farmers pest control costs

A new study published in the Journal of Agricultural Economics found that planting flower strips in apple orchards can reduce damage from pests by up to 32% and save farmers money. The research, conducted by the University of Reading, found that farmers could save up to £2,997 per hectare in years with high pest activity.

How to stop being surprised by extreme weather - study

A team of researchers has developed a toolkit to predict extreme weather events by combining conventional records with historical and natural archives. By analyzing tree rings, creating 'what-if' scenarios, and using climate models, scientists can now reconstruct centuries of drought patterns and uncover forgotten weather extremes.

Bigger animals get more cancer, defying decades-old belief

Researchers found that larger species have higher cancer rates than smaller ones, with some species even having better natural defences against cancer. The study challenged the long-standing Peto's paradox and provided insight into how superior mechanisms of cellular defence can evolve in larger species.

Ocean-surface warming four times faster now than late-1980s

A new study found that ocean temperatures have more than quadrupled since the late 1980s, rising from 0.06°C/decade to 0.27°C/decade. This accelerating warming is driven by the Earth's growing energy imbalance and is expected to lead to even more rapid temperature increases in the future.

Snowflake dance analysis could improve rain forecasts

A new study has found that analyzing the physical motion of falling snowflakes can improve rainfall predictions by estimating where and when ice crystals will melt into raindrops. The research revealed four main types of ice crystal motion, including stable, zigzag, transitional, and spiralling movements.

Tropical Atlantic mixing rewrites climate pattern rules

Researchers have discovered that changes in the ocean's mixed layer are the primary force behind Atlantic Multidecadal Variability (AMV) in the tropics. This phenomenon influences weather patterns across North America, Europe, and Africa, affecting hurricane activity and rainfall in regions like the Sahel.

Strong El Nino makes European winters easier to forecast

A new study found that strong El Nino events make it easier to forecast European winters, allowing for more accurate predictions of temperature and precipitation patterns. The research team analyzed 30 years of winter forecasts from seven different prediction systems and identified common factors influencing predictability.

AI weather forecasts captured Ciaran’s destructive path

A new study by the University of Reading demonstrated that AI weather forecasts can predict storm paths and intensities with similar accuracy to traditional models. However, AI systems underestimated Storm Ciaran's maximum wind speeds due to limitations in predicting certain atmospheric features.
